In a voting population of college-educated, urban-based, media-literate, liberal-minded, internet-savvy students 17 to 21 years old — who would win as President?

Find out!

Results of the Mock Presidential Elections conducted by the Department of Journalism at the U.P. College of Mass Communication will be released in a presscon/ media conference tomorrow, Tuesday, March 2, at 10am on occasion of Mass Com Week at the UPCMC Auditorium.
